Cooler, Showery Conditions Expected Across UK Following Weekend Rain

The UK is set for a week of cooler temperatures and intermittent showers, despite recent heavy rainfall clearing. Forecasters predict an unsettled pattern will dominate, bringing a noticeable shift from earlier warmer conditions.

  • Recent heavy rain across the UK has now largely cleared.
  • The week ahead will see a return to cooler temperatures.
  • Showery conditions are forecast to persist throughout the week.
  • This follows a period of warmer, more settled weather in some areas.

The UK has been bracing itself for a return to typical spring conditions after a weekend of heavy rainfall left its mark across various regions. Forecasters predict a continuation of showery and cooler temperatures, with no extreme weather events anticipated but widespread intermittent showers expected to affect the country throughout the week.

Meteorological offices have indicated that temperatures will remain below average for this time of year, bringing a fresh feel to the air. This marks a significant departure from the warmer spells experienced earlier in the month and signals a return to more typical British weather patterns.

The change in conditions may impact outdoor activities and travel plans, with motorists advised to be vigilant for wet road conditions and reduced visibility. The agricultural sector may welcome the rainfall after any dry spells but could face challenges due to persistent cooler temperatures that slow crop growth.

Local authorities and emergency services are monitoring the situation closely, particularly concerning surface water flooding risks in urban areas or potential disruption to public transport networks. While severe impacts are not predicted, showery weather can sometimes lead to localised issues over several days.

The broader implications for UK citizens include adapting daily routines to the cooler and wetter conditions. Clothing choices and outdoor leisure plans will likely be influenced by the unsettled weather, which is expected to persist for most of the week before potentially stabilising.
